news 2026/4/16 9:07:46

Frappe Gantt终极指南:打造高效项目时间线可视化的完整方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Frappe Gantt终极指南:打造高效项目时间线可视化的完整方案

Frappe Gantt终极指南:打造高效项目时间线可视化的完整方案

【免费下载链接】ganttOpen Source Javascript Gantt项目地址: https://gitcode.com/gh_mirrors/ga/gantt

Frappe Gantt是一款现代化的开源JavaScript甘特图库,专为Web应用设计,能够帮助开发者和项目经理轻松创建美观、可定制的时间线可视化图表。作为项目管理工具中的重要组成部分,这款甘特图库提供了丰富的功能和灵活的配置选项。

5分钟快速部署Frappe Gantt

通过简单的安装步骤,你可以快速将Frappe Gantt集成到你的项目中:

npm install frappe-gantt

或者通过CDN直接引入:

<script src="https://cdn.jsdelivr.net/npm/frappe-gantt/dist/frappe-gantt.umd.js"></script> <link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/frappe-gantt/dist/frappe-gantt.css">

核心功能深度解析

智能时间线管理

Frappe Gantt支持多种时间视图模式,从小时到年,满足不同粒度的项目规划需求。通过src/defaults.js文件中的配置,你可以轻松定制时间线的显示方式。

节假日智能排除

系统能够自动识别并排除周末和其他节假日,确保项目进度计算的准确性。在demo.js示例中,你可以看到如何配置各种节假日规则。

多语言国际化支持

具备完整的国际化能力,适合拥有国际团队的企业使用。

最佳配置实践指南

通过src/styles/目录下的CSS文件,你可以对甘特图进行深度定制:

  • 主题切换:支持深色和浅色主题的无缝切换
  • 间距控制:灵活调整任务条之间的间距
  • 颜色主题:自定义任务条的颜色和样式效果

实际应用场景展示

Frappe Gantt适用于各种规模的项目管理需求:

  • 个人项目跟踪:从简单的个人任务管理到复杂的项目规划
  • 团队协作管理:帮助团队跟踪项目目标和里程碑
  • 企业级应用:大型企业如ERPNext已经在生产环境中使用Frappe Gantt

开发环境搭建教程

如果你想为Frappe Gantt贡献代码或进行功能定制:

  1. 克隆仓库:git clone https://gitcode.com/gh_mirrors/ga/gantt
  2. 进入项目目录并安装依赖:pnpm i
  3. 构建项目:pnpm run build
  • 或使用开发模式:pnpm run build-dev实时查看变更效果
  1. 在浏览器中打开index.html进行测试
  2. 根据需求修改代码并验证功能

样式定制技巧分享

通过src/styles/dark.css和src/styles/light.css文件,你可以轻松实现主题切换。src/styles/gantt.css则包含了核心样式配置。

总结与展望

Frappe Gantt凭借其简洁的API设计、丰富的定制选项和出色的视觉效果,已经成为项目时间线可视化的首选工具。无论你是前端开发者还是项目经理,这款工具都能帮助你快速构建专业的项目管理界面。

通过本指南,你已经掌握了Frappe Gantt的核心功能和快速上手方法。现在就开始使用Frappe Gantt,让你的项目时间线管理变得更加简单高效!

【免费下载链接】ganttOpen Source Javascript Gantt项目地址: https://gitcode.com/gh_mirrors/ga/gantt

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/16 9:06:57

Sketch Measure插件完整教程:3步搞定专业设计标注的终极指南

Sketch Measure插件完整教程&#xff1a;3步搞定专业设计标注的终极指南 【免费下载链接】sketch-measure Make it a fun to create spec for developers and teammates 项目地址: https://gitcode.com/gh_mirrors/sk/sketch-measure 还在为设计标注效率低下而烦恼&…

作者头像 李华
网站建设 2026/4/16 9:04:03

Flutter跨平台直播应用开发:从零到一的完整实战指南

Flutter跨平台直播应用开发&#xff1a;从零到一的完整实战指南 【免费下载链接】pure_live A Flutter project can make you watch live with ease. 项目地址: https://gitcode.com/gh_mirrors/pu/pure_live PureLive是一款基于Flutter框架打造的跨平台直播观看应用&am…

作者头像 李华
网站建设 2026/4/15 13:12:45

机械键盘PCB设计工程化指南:从模块化架构到量产优化

机械键盘PCB设计工程化指南&#xff1a;从模块化架构到量产优化 【免费下载链接】HelloWord-Keyboard 项目地址: https://gitcode.com/gh_mirrors/he/HelloWord-Keyboard 在个性化外设需求日益增长的今天&#xff0c;机械键盘DIY已经从简单的组装升级为完整的硬件开发过…

作者头像 李华
网站建设 2026/4/15 4:05:19

M2FP模型在远程医疗中的应用:患者姿势监测

M2FP模型在远程医疗中的应用&#xff1a;患者姿势监测 &#x1f3e5; 远程医疗的挑战与AI视觉的破局点 随着远程医疗的快速发展&#xff0c;医生对患者的非接触式状态评估需求日益增长。传统视频问诊仅能提供有限的视觉信息&#xff0c;难以量化患者的身体姿态、活动能力或康复…

作者头像 李华
网站建设 2026/4/9 17:10:59

操作系统期末复习——第6章:死锁

目录6.1 资源6.2 死锁简介6.2.1 ⭐死锁的定义6.2.2 ⭐死锁的条件&#xff08;缺一不可&#xff09;6.2.3 资源分配图6.2.3 解决死锁6.3 鸵鸟算法6.4 死锁检测和死锁恢复6.4.1 死锁检测6.4.2 ⭐死锁恢复6.5 ⭐死锁避免6.6 ⭐死锁预防6.6.1 破坏互斥条件6.6.2 破坏占有并等待条件…

作者头像 李华
网站建设 2026/4/15 4:52:41

QLVideo完全指南:解锁macOS视频预览新境界

QLVideo完全指南&#xff1a;解锁macOS视频预览新境界 【免费下载链接】QLVideo This package allows macOS Finder to display thumbnails, static QuickLook previews, cover art and metadata for most types of video files. 项目地址: https://gitcode.com/gh_mirrors/q…

作者头像 李华